**About You**

**Coordinator Role**:

- 1 year minimum working in the childcare sector, even if you have been an educator and wanting to progress we would love to hear from you.
- Experience or willingness to learn in programming for school aged children that responds to each child’s well-being, positive sense of identity and confidence as a learner and participant
- Behavior training is essential
- Ensuring staff members are aware of and are adhering to legislative requirements, relevant awards and agreements, OSHC Policy and Procedures, Workplace Health & Safety Policy and Procedures, Child Protection Guidelines/Processes, Practicing confidentiality in relation to all aspects of the role
- Ability to build and maintain strong positive relationships with staff and families
- Completed or working towards a cert III, Cert IV, teaching degree OR diploma
- Ensuring the health and safety of the children in their care
- Excellent communication and organizational skills
- Ability to build partnerships with families and the local community
- Administering first aid and medication, when required and fulfilling all associated legislative requirements
- First aid 004, WWCC & child protection certificate
- Passionate and driven for the sector
- Fun and want to be part of a team attitude
- Sound working knowledge of the National Quality Framework and ‘My Time Our Place’ or willing to learn
- Available to work at least 8 of the 10 shifts available per week.
